Right, in order for Catalytic converter it needs to get hot enough to burn the unburn fuel, intended to burn as much shyt as possible. It does change the chemical structure. It takes several minutes to something like 15 minutes before catalytic converter actually start to work.

But most people dont realize the cats dont work when cold.
They are like afterburners, extremely red hot/glowing hot inside to burn the excess fuels.... what heats them, the exhaust from the motor. So until they reach a working temp, they are useless anyways.

white smoke is water vapors..harmless
Black smoke is raw gas that didnt burn
Blue smoke is oil burning from bad rings or valve guide seals...
